riku
2026-04-02 3282e95db0207ee133d1e98d9771dec9d83b0fc4
miniprogram_npm/tdesign-miniprogram/slider/slider.d.ts
@@ -18,10 +18,17 @@
    scaleTextArray: any[];
    _value: SliderValue;
    prefix: string;
    realLabel: string | string[];
    extremeLabel: string[];
    isVisibleToScreenReader: boolean;
    identifier: number[];
    __inited: boolean;
};
export default class Slider extends SuperComponent {
    externalClasses: string[];
    options: {
        pureDataPattern: RegExp;
    };
    properties: import("./type").TdSliderProps;
    controlledProps: {
        key: string;
@@ -32,16 +39,25 @@
        value(newValue: SliderValue): void;
        _value(newValue: SliderValue): void;
        marks(val: any): void;
        label(val: any): void;
        'showExtremeValue, min, max'(): void;
    };
    getwExtremeLabel(): void;
    lifetimes: {
        created(): void;
        attached(): void;
    };
    injectPageScroll(): void;
    observerScrollTop(rest: any): void;
    toggleA11yTips(): void;
    renderLine(val: any): void;
    triggerValue(value?: SliderValue): void;
    getLabelByValue(value: SliderValue, position?: 'start' | 'end' | 'min' | 'max'): any;
    handlePropsChange(newValue: SliderValue): void;
    handleMask(marks: any): void;
    valueToPosition(value: number): number;
    handleMark(marks: any): void;
    setSingleBarWidth(value: number): void;
    getInitialStyle(): Promise<void>;
    init(): Promise<void>;
    stepValue(value: number): number;
    onSingleLineTap(e: WechatMiniprogram.TouchEvent): void;
    getSingleChangeValue(e: WechatMiniprogram.TouchEvent): number;
@@ -52,5 +68,6 @@
    onTouchMoveRight(e: WechatMiniprogram.TouchEvent): void;
    setLineStyle(left: number, right: number): void;
    onTouchEnd(e: WechatMiniprogram.TouchEvent): void;
    getPagePosition(touch: any): any;
}
export {};